Methods for Clearing Away Debris and Contaminants
Reliable approaches for extracting debris and contaminants from water bodies play a vital role in preserving water quality and ecosystem health. Among the most widely-used methods are mechanical removal and chemical treatments. Mechanical removal involves utilizing specialized equipment, such as skimmers and dredgers, to physically extract debris like leaves, algae, and sediment from the water. This approach limits disruption to the aquatic environment while effectively reducing pollutant levels.
Chemical-based treatments, like algaecides and herbicides, can target specific contaminants but need to be utilized cautiously to prevent harming non-target species. Bio-based methods, including introducing beneficial microorganisms, offer an sustainable alternative for breaking down organic waste and pollutants.
Consistent monitoring of water quality can guide the implementation of these approaches, ensuring ideal results. By implementing a combination of these methods, pond and lake managers can significantly enhance the health and sustainability of aquatic ecosystems.

Enhancing Water Quality for Wildlife
Although the health of aquatic ecosystems is essential for supporting wide-ranging wildlife, enhancing water quality remains a fundamental challenge for pond and lake managers. Elevated nutrient levels, often stemming from runoff, can result in harmful algal blooms that deplete oxygen and threaten aquatic life. Successful management practices emphasize reducing these nutrient inputs through buffer zones and sediment control.
In addition, maintaining proper pH levels and temperature is important for the health of vulnerable species. Supervisors often monitor these parameters carefully to ensure a balanced ecosystem. The incorporation of native plant species can improve water filtration and provide habitats for fish and invertebrates, consequently supporting biodiversity.
Routine evaluations and modifications to management strategies are essential, as conditions can change rapidly. Eventually, the commitment to bettering water quality not only benefits wildlife but also boosts the recreational value of aquatic environments for the neighboring residents.

Eco-Friendly Cleaning Approaches
Sustainable management of ponds and lakes progressively focuses on natural cleaning methods, which utilize the capacity of ecosystems to reinstate water quality without harmful chemicals. These approaches include the introduction of beneficial bacteria and enzymes that decompose organic matter, therefore promoting a balanced ecosystem. Aquatic plants play an essential role by absorbing excess nutrients, which assists in regulating algae growth. Additionally, utilizing natural predators, such as fish species that consume unwanted pests, can sustain a healthy aquatic environment. Regularly aerating the water boosts oxygen levels, promoting the breakdown of pollutants. By implementing these natural techniques, water bodies can realize improved clarity and health while preserving the delicate balance of their ecosystems, ultimately generating sustainable and effective management practices.
